Why Choose Resin for Your Garden?
Designed for the UK's variable weather, resin won’t absorb rainwater, and holds its tone even with long periods in the sun. This ensures longevity. Compared to cast iron, resin is easier to handle, making it effortless to store when needed.
Cleaning is simple: soapy water and a sponge usually tackles bird droppings. There’s no need for sanding or painting, keeping long-term costs down.

Caring for Resin Furniture
In the drier seasons, a simple wipe usually is enough. For persistent marks, apply soapy water and sponge gently. To keep fabric in good condition, cover during rain when not in use.
Avoid placing hot objects directly on resin, as heat can cause warping.
